We’d Like to Introduce you to the work of Keith Rankin

Filed under: Journal Entry — June 2, 2008 @ 8:04 pm

Keith Rankin is one our favorites over at PBase for his amazing work with all kinds of birds.  We think you will enjoy his hummingbird gallery, and especially some of his new photos.  The  Rufus-Sitting is one of my favorites and the male Caliope is also amazing.  They are all amazing.

Keith’s images of Snowy Owls are without a doubt the best images of the Snowy I’ve ever seen.   The Great Grey Owls are fantastic, as well.  As are the many other galleries.

Be sure to thumb through this incredible work of Keith’s.

We’d Like You to Experience the Work of Anna Pagnacco

Filed under: Journal Entry — April 28, 2008 @ 6:43 pm

Anna is an amazing and talented photographer from Italy. Her black and white images of the Alps are amazing, and her photos of the Masks of Carnival in Venice are the best I’ve seen. She has many galleries but I can not forget to mention her portrait work, and in particular, A Journey into the Soul gallery.

Hope you enjoy her work as much as we do.
